4 confirmed dead in daylight bank robbery [PHOTOS]

The victims of the incident are three policemen who were outside the bank and a teenage girl who was hawking fish in the area.

Four people have been confirmed dead in Lagos State after a gang of robbers invaded a bank in the Lekki area of the state.

The robbers, numbering about 12, were said to have arrived in the area at about 5pm through a waterway.

They were said to have announced their arrival by shooting sporadically with their automatic weapons before making their entry into the bank.

“Those killed included a 15-year-old girl, who sold fish opposite the bank. She was hit by a stray bullet. Another man, also killed, was said to be a policeman in mufti,” an eyewitness, Femi Olatunji told Vanguard.

“The other two policemen were escorts to expatriates of an oil company. The expatriates were seated in a white coaster bus, while the policemen occupied the back seat. They did not collect the expatriate’s briefcases after killing the policemen. They left with boxes of money, before other policemen arrived,” he added.

“They were shooting non-stop for about 30 minutes, I saw a policeman and two others persons on the floor with blood gushing out of them. Some policemen tried to engage them, but the robbers were very brutal. They eventually robbed the bank,” another witness, Kola Alade, told Punch.

The incident was confirmed by the police spokesperson for the state, Kenneth Nwosu.

"Three policemen who stood gallantly defending the facility were killed in the process,” Nwosu said.

“Investigation has already commenced and we have launched a serious manhunt on the robbers. We will ensure that we trace their hideout and track them down,” he added.

The robbers were said to have escaped in a speedboat which they reportedly arrived the scene with.
